This metaphor uses a sad song as a metaphor for the troubles of joblessness, bankruptcy, and despair proliferating across the country. Metaphor: Song as MisfortuneĪ man in the Hooverville tells Bud and Bugs, "You might think or you might hear that things are better just down the line, but they're singing the same sad song all over this country" (68). Bud never forgets this, and finds himself thinking of these metaphorical doors as he undertakes his adventure to find his father. ![]() It allows Bud to think about the moments in his life that signify a change and to know that even if something seems bad or confusing, it will lead to something good in the future. This common metaphor uses a door to suggest opportunity. Momma tells Bud, ".no matter how dark the night, when one door closes, don't worry, because another door opens" (43). The Vestrits live in Bingtown, which borders the sea, Jamaillia, Chalced, and the Rain Wilds. ![]() Vivacia is the ship bought by the Vestrit family, who are still in debt to the Rain Wilder for the price of the Wizardwood. Only a liveship is capable of crossing the perilous Rain Wild River to trade with the Rain Wilders, who have valuable goods plundered from an ancient Elderling ruin. When three generations of a ship's owners die on board, a liveship "quickens", becoming a sentient being with a personality, the memories of the dead ancestors, and a psychic connection to living family members. Synopsis Setting Ī liveship is a ship made of Wizardwood, a mystical substance from up the Rain Wild River. Ship of Magic is a 1998 fantasy novel by American writer Robin Hobb, the first in her Liveship Traders Trilogy. 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() Asuka finds himself drawn to Ryo, but she likes only the manliest of men!
